Dianella variegated is a striking and hardy plant choice for New Zealand gardens, prized for its bold foliage and low-maintenance nature. With distinctive green leaves striped with creamy white or silver, variegated Dianella varieties provide year-round interest and texture in garden beds, borders, and containers. Ideal for modern landscapes, coastal gardens, and even shaded spots, these tough evergreen perennials thrive in diverse conditions while adding light and movement to garden designs. Whether you’re after groundcover, edging, or a feature plant, dianella variegated is an adaptable and reliable choice.

Dianella 'Margaret Pringle' bears spikes carrying delicate, blue flowers in spring, which are followed by small, blue berries in summer. These are held neatly above the variegated, strap-like leaves, which are coloured yellow and green. It typically grows to 50 cm tall and the same wide. Dianella 'Margaret Pringle' is commonly included in a mixed planting or border, used in cottage gardens, or mass planted either on a bank or as a groundcover.

Dianella Blue Twist bears spikes that may reach 1 m in length carrying delicate, light blue flowers. These are held above the blue-green, strap-like leaves, and typically grows to 50 cm tall and the same wide. Dianella Blue Twist is commonly mass planted in borders or as a groundcover, included in a mixed planting, or planted around outdoor living areas.
